The Current State
2015 AVMA Report on Veterinary Compensation
Median Professional Income of Private Practitioners
2011: $100,000 2013: $94,000
Mean Professional Income of Private Practitioners
2011: $118,726 2013: $129,031
Skewed distribution due to a few of the highest incomes pulling the
mean above the median
2015 AVMA Report on Veterinary Compensation
But, in terms of real (2003) dollars
Mean income in 2013 was less than 2007 and 2009
Bayer Veterinary Care Usage Study
Economy
Improving now, but tough 5-8 years ago
Cycles
Not if, but when
Lean organizations use slow times to get “leaner”
Bayer Veterinary Care Usage Study
“Dr. Google”
39% of pet owners report looking on-line first
15% report relying less on their veterinarian
If clinical signs resolve within 1-2 days,
vets never get to see the pet
Bayer Veterinary Care Usage Study
“Sticker Shock”
26% would switch veterinarians if a
less expensive service was found
One of the two lowest scores practices received was
for value of services
The benchmark for retained clients is 60% at 18 months
“Give your Practice a Physical Exam”, Mark Opperman, Veterinary Economics, Nov., 1, 2013
Bayer Veterinary Care Usage Study
Fragmentation of Veterinary Services
Low cost spay/neuter clinics
Low cost vaccination clinics
Clinics/Hospitals located within pet stores
Specialty practices
